Definition of dayward in English:

dayward

adverb ˈdeɪwəd
poetic
  • Towards the day or the sun. Also (as noun) in "to (the) dayward".

adjective ˈdeɪwəd
poetic
  • Directed towards the day or the sun.

Origin

Early 17th century; earliest use found in Joshua Sylvester (d. 1618), poet and translator. From day + -ward.
